The NCDOT Ferry Division is a unique and encompassing system that supports residents and visitors in the eastern North Carolina coastal regions. The NC Ferry Division consists of over 350 employees who operate 21 ferries over seven established routes. These operations are supported by another 150 employees who maintain the vessels in a full-service shipyard as well as the employees who operate and maintain the dredge, crane barge, support tugs, and its support vessels necessary to keep the channels and basins operational. In order to maintain, operate, and plan the needs of the Division there are several working units that provide professional services such as Vessel Asset Management, Marine Asset Management, Business Office, Operations, Safety, Security, Planning and Development, Environmental, Facility Maintenance, Quality Assurance, and Engineering.

The Human Resources Unit provides the Ferry Division with resources for staffing operations with qualified personnel. The HR Programs Coordinator IV will be the recruiting coordinator for the Ferry Division and will be the lead on organizing career fairs and recruiting on social media and on job sites. They will also be responsible for scheduling training and continue education for USCG licensed personnel with maritime schools and work with employees on advancement opportunities.  Work includes establishing career paths with NCDOT HR that best aligns with Ferry Division needs. The position will also be responsible for ensuring that all state and federal laws personnel policy and agency standards are met. Employees perform high-level administrative work in developing and maintaining division functionality. Work is performed under limited supervision and includes the supervision of staff who are in facilities located in other parts of the state.

The program area for this position includes experience working in job recruitment and/or experience in Human Resources.
